About 3 weeks ago I won an auction on eBay for an item I really wanted. Days went by and the item wasn't shipped, the sellers feedback had some history of shipping late, not a lot but nevertheless there was a history. This gave me great concern. I waited and waited and still no word. I sent the seller several messages without a reply and my concern became greater. On Wednesday I clicked on the button that I did not receive my item on the eBay site. A very short time later I got a message from the seller that they would ship my item the next day. Yesterday I got a message from eBay that I was getting a full refund. That upset me because I did not request a refund, I wanted the item. Today I got a message thru eBay from the seller that they were sorry and they issued me the refund and my item was on the way. I was really surprised to be getting a full refund and also will be receiving the item. I forgot to mention, the seller did say they were hospitalized for a bit.
